Jordan wants to play a basketball game at a carnival. The game costs the player \$5$5dollar sign, 5 to play, and the player gets

to take two long-distance shots. If they miss both shots, they get nothing. If they make one shot, they get their \$5$5dollar sign, 5 back. If they make both shots, they get \$10$10dollar sign, 10 back. Jordan has a 40\%40%40, percent chance of making this type of shot.

Based on the payoffs and the probabilities given, we can calculate the mean to be <u>0.8 shots made. </u>

<h3>What is the mean?</h3>

The mean in this scenario will be a weighted average of the probabilities that a number of shots will be made.

The mean will be:

<em>= ∑ (Number of shots x Probability of number of shots)</em>

= (0 x 0.36) + (1 x 0.48) + (2 x 0.16)

= 0.8 shots

In conclusion, the mean is 0.8 shots.

For close to 50 years, educators and politicians from classrooms to the Oval Office have stressed the importance of graduating students who are skilled critical thinkers.

Content that once had to be drilled into students’ heads is now just a phone swipe away, but the ability to make sense of that information requires thinking critically about it. Similarly, our democracy is today imperiled not by lack of access to data and opinions about the most important issues of the day, but rather by our inability to sort the true from the fake (or hopelessly biased).

We have certainly made progress in critical-thinking education over the last five decades. Courses dedicated to the subject can be found in the catalogs of many colleges and universities, while the latest generation of K-12 academic standards emphasize not just content but also the skills necessary to think critically about content taught in English, math, science and social studies classes.
